    The primary difference between decimal and binary is the number of digits used to represent numbers. Decimal uses 10 digits (0-9), while binary uses only 2 digits (0 and 1).

      Decimal to binary conversion is a relatively simple process, but it requires a solid understanding of the binary number system. In decimal, numbers are represented using the base-10 system, which uses 10 digits (0-9). Binary, on the other hand, uses the base-2 system, consisting of only two digits: 0 and 1. To convert a decimal number to binary, you need to repeatedly divide the number by 2 and record the remainder as either 0 or 1. This process is repeated until the quotient is 0.
